Maptech Pro vs Coastal explorer
For those interested, Maptech bought their program from Coastal and they
are identical except Maptech has a 3-D bottom feature which seems quite worthless after trying it out at the Seattle boatshow. Maptech also only allows the program to be loaded twice. If you need more, you need to call them and they MIGHT give you the code to load it once more. Coastal doesn't care. Maptech is higher priced, but both are nice programs and are far superior to Seaclear (except price, of course).
